Book Synopsis Curse of the Wicked Scoundrel by : Sadie Bosque

Download or read book Curse of the Wicked Scoundrel written by Sadie Bosque and published by The Shadows. This book was released on 2021-12-26 with total page 330 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: People call him Hades. He is like the dark prince himself: enigmatic, mysterious, and dangerous. Nobody knows his real name. Nobody knows anything about him. He has been cursed to lead his life in loneliness, because everyone who's ever been close to him very soon died. Eloise Gunning is hard-working and practical. She helps her brother with his work, keeps to herself, and is set to marry a safe, decent young man. Her entire life is planned out. Suddenly, her world tilts on its axis when she is kidnapped and confined in the lair of the beastly man. Nothing is as it seems in this strange place, especially not its owner. Eloise cannot deny her attraction to the dark and powerful man, nor the pull of his irresistible kisses. As their bond strengthens, the world around them begins to crumble, forcing them to wonder: is the curse real? And can they break it before it's too late?
